Could you be the Blessington Rose? The Rose of Tralee International Festival is emerging from a two-year break & plans to hold Rose Selections in local communities. In Blessington, this is being facilitated by Blessington & District Forum & the Wicklow Rose Coordinator. We are therefore looking for young people (Roses & Escorts) between the ages of 18 & 30 to participate in a Blessington Rose selection festival (1st May in Tulfarris House Hotel) which will select the Blessington Rose who will then go forward to the Wicklow Rose selection on 5th June in Arklow & if successful, to the national event 19th to 23rd August in Tralee. Special Collection for Ukraine: The Irish Bishops have asked for a Special Collection to be taken up at Masses this weekend 26th & 27th March to support humanitarian efforts in Ukraine and especially the families and children who have had to flee their homeland in advance of the Russian invasion. The proceeds of this Special Collection will be directed to Caritas Internationalis, which is the helping hand of the Church on the ground in the Ukraine and the surrounding region. Please be as generous as you can. This will replace the SHARE Collection
